Charles Stanley Blair
Biography of Charles Stanley Blair
Biographic Details
- Family Name (Surname): Blair
- First Name: Charles
- Middle Name: Stanley
- Date of Birth: December , 20 , 1927
- Place of Birth (POB): Kingsville , Maryland (US-MD, MD, 24, Md.)
- Date of Death: April , 20 , 1980
- Place of Death (POD): Fallston , Maryland (US-MD, MD, 24, Md.)
- Gender Identity: Male
- Race or Ethnicity: White
Charles Stanley Blair Court Service Information
- Court Name: United States District Court, District of Maryland
- Court Type: United States District Court
- Appointment under the Presidency of: Richard M. Nixon ( Republican )
- Judge Nomination vote date (as recorded in the Senate Executive Journal): 07/14/1971
- American Bar Association (ABA) Ratings of judicial nominees (majority rating): Qualified
- New Seat
- Authorization legislation: 84 Stat. 294
- Referral of Nominations to Judiciary Committee Date: 07/14/1971
- Committee action: Reported With Recommendation
- Committee action date: 07/28/1971
- Senate voice vote?: Yes
- Senate vote Date (Confirmation Date): 07/29/1971
- Commission Date: 07/29/1971
- Date of Termination: 04/20/1980
- Termination of function of Judge (specific reason): Death
Charles Stanley Blair in the Law School
- Name of School: University of Maryland
- Degree: Bachelor of Science (B.S.)
- Law Degree Year: 1951
Second Law School Attendance
- Law Degree (Name of School): University of Maryland School of Law
- Degree: Bachelor of Laws (LL.B.)
- Law Degree Year: 1953
Charles Stanley Blair Career Path
Employment:
- U.S. Maritime Service, 1945-1947
- U.S. Army captain, 1953-1956
- Private practice, Bel Air, Maryland, 1961-1969
- State delegate, Maryland, 1963-1967
- Secretary of state, State of Maryland, 1967-1969
- Chief of staff, U.S. Vice President Spiro Agnew, 1969-1970
